One of my computers finished it's last 2 task and now it isn't downloading new tasks, but I have no problem with another computer with the same config.
At the Project Tab, the status is "---" At Messages Tab: "Sending scheduler request: Requested by User. Requesting 0 seconds of work, reporting 0 completed tasks" "Scheduler request succeded: got 0 new tasks" I'm subscribed to "Help Fight Childhood Cancer" Project, but selected the "If there is no work available for my computer......" option Any ideas? |

Oh yes!! And how are you all?
----------------------------------------I did report on a thread, at the BOINC Message Boards, http://boinc.berkeley.edu/dev/forum_thread.php?id=4561 after running dry at Connect every = .30 and Additional work = 0.00, my next step was to take the suggestion to put Additional work = 2.0. While I am using Activity = Prefs, I did set up a profile for just the Win7 computer to mirror the local prefs. If is this redundant, that's fine. That did the trick. I have been fine now for a couple of weeks. I slowly added projects. I have been checking Results on all of the projects on this machine and everything is positive. I check every couple of days. I wrote the post there because so many of the suggestions I got, including Sek's, were in that thread. I also expressed my thanks and gratitude for all of the help I received. While credits are not my interest, I can say that I have gone from generally less than 1000 per day to between 3000 and 4000 per day. I still think that the Win7 64 bit O/S combined with the I7-920 and higher processors are really new territory for BOINC. Possibly this should mean a review of the defaults. If this work is to attract less technical people - like me- they need to have an easier time of it getting going. My new machine is relatively ordinary for a new purchase. Thanks again. |

While credits are not my interest, I can say that I have gone from generally less than 1000 per day to between 3000 and 4000 per day. Although most of us in this forum use credits for some kind of competition or another, one must not forget that they are also (first?) a measurement tool to help us quickly see if things are running as they should. Since BOINC is supposed to run in a stealth way without clobbering our monitors with lots of messages or windows while we want to do something else it is important that there is a simple way to quickly check if it is producing useful work as expected. At first, I thought I had the same situation. (See original post)
One of several pc's acting strangely (Requesting 0 seconds of work), was crunching Muscular Dystrophy, but recently changed to HCC. My task list kept getting shorter and shorter. One evening I went to bed with only one task available to work on... but the next morning the pc was working on a (different) new task. I checked all the options I occasionally change but couldn't see anything unusual. Rebooted (it's probably been a month since I've done that), Reset project, checked for latest software version. I though perhaps I had set the additional work buffer to .05 days instead of 5 days..... None of this changed what I was seeing. However, when I changed the work buffer to 6 days and updated, I was rewarded with a number of files being downloaded... but these new tasks do not show up; all I see is the current task progress and one more task available for work. The good news, the machine still crunches.... I'm just curious as to why I can't see the tasks, and what can I do to get the list visible again. This is one of 3 machines configured pretty much the same; All are 6 or more years old (hey, it's better that recycling!), running XP, with regular Windows updates. I haven't installed any new software (or hardware drivers) on any of them for the past several months. Comments or suggestions welcome! |

If you have a really new version of the BOINC Manager and are looking at the Advanced tab you may hve clicked on the "Show Active Tasks" button (which will now say "Show All Tasks"). Click this and see if all your other tasks appear.
